Elsewhere in the deposition, she talked about an undated visit to Club Tramp with Prince Andrew, where he ordered them “clear drinks” from the bar and said that her drink contained alcohol.The Telegraphidentified the hub as a members-only club in London.

Giuffre’s deposition is part of the final round of documents released relating to a defamation lawsuit she filed against Maxwell in 2015, which was settled in 2017, theAssociated Pressreported. The release of the documents, whichbegan last week, was ordered on Dec. 18, 2023, and “did not contain the explosive revelations or new identities of abusers that some had predicted,” the AP said.

While calls for an investigation into King Charles' younger brother intensified after he wasnamed in the court filingslinked to Epstein unsealed last week, British police say there are no plans for a probe at this time. Last Friday, the Metropolitan Police said in a statement, “We are aware of the release of court documents in relation to Jeffrey Epstein. As with any matter, should new and relevant information be brought to our attention we will assess it. No investigation has been launched,” according toSky News.

Prince Andrew, 63, previously admitted to knowing Epstein but has denied any wrongdoing.

In 2019, the Duke of York sat for aninterview with the BBC, where he also said he had “no recollection of ever meeting" Giuffre. When journalist Emily Maitlis raised the issue of a photo showing the royal with his arm around Giuffre’s waist, he claimed, “I have absolutely no memory of that photograph ever being taken.”
